A vase contains 7 red flowers, 3 white flowers, and 5 yellow flowers. If George selects a flower from the vase for his wife, wha t is the probability that he will select a red one.
1 answer:
Answer:
The answer to your question is: P(A) = 0.47
Step-by-step explanation:
Data
7 red flowers
3 white flowers
5 yellow flowers
Probability that he select a red one
Formula
P(A) = Number of favorable cases of A / total number of outcomes
Number of favorable cases = 7
Total number of outcomes = 7 + 3 + 5 = 15
Substitution
P(A) = 7 / 15
P(A) = 0.47
